The Los Angeles Lakers are entering a pivotal stretch of their season as they gear up to face the San Antonio Spurs. Following a recent schedule adjustment due to catastrophic wildfires in Southern California, the team's readiness for the upcoming game at Crypto.com Arena remains in question.

Recent Performance

The Lakers last played on January 7, suffering a significant 118-97 loss to the Dallas Mavericks. This defeat was particularly concerning as the Mavericks competed without their star players, Luka Doncic and Kyrie Irving. The Lakers' struggles in that game raised alarms among fans and analysts regarding their current form.

Injury Report

Head coach J.J. Redick's roster is currently challenged by a series of injuries. LeBron James is managing a left foot injury and is listed as probable for the upcoming game against the Spurs. While he is expected to participate, the injury may hinder his performance.

Anthony Davis is also on the injury list with plantar fasciitis, sharing a probable status for the matchup. Additionally, Bronny James is considered questionable due to an unspecified illness, which could impede his ability to play.

Confirmed absences include Jarred Vanderbilt, Jalen Hood-Schifino, and Christian Wood. Both Wood and Hood-Schifino might return for the subsequent game on January 15, while Vanderbilt is not anticipated to rejoin the team until January 17.
